#FFCCE9 Hex color

#FFCCE9

The hexadecimal color code #FFCCE9 corresponds to the code RGB( 255, 204, 233 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 1,00 level), green (at 0,80 level) and blue (at 0,91 level). Its brightness is 90% and its saturation is 100%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 29% and blue at 33%.

The complementary color #003316 is the color exactly opposite to #FFCCE9 on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#FFCCE9 in CSS

When using #FFCCE9 as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#FFCCE9 as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
